To signal in a vehicle the desire to turn right or left.
To investigate the condition or power of, as of steam engine, by means of an indicator.
*1903', "How to '''indicate an engine" in ''The Star Improved Steam Engine Indicator , p.64:
*:To a person who is familiar with the use of an indicator, whether it be of one make or another, it is needless to give instructions as to how an engine should be indicated ,.
*1905 , Power , Vol.25, p.448:
*:I found it fully as easy to indicate an engine at a speed of 320 to 340 revolutions as at 80.
*1905 , Central Station , Vol.5, p.76:
*:An indicator will give the working of these valves at all times and soon return its cost in higher engine efficiency. The day has passed when it was only the expert who could indicate an engine or afford to own an indicator.
